Specification Comparison
| Parameter | LM6588MA/NOPBSource | LM6588MAX/NOPB | LM6588MA |
|---|---|---|---|
| Manufacturer | Texas Instruments | Texas Instruments | Texas Instruments |
| Package Type | Small Outline Packages | Small Outline Packages | Small Outline Packages |
| Pin Count | 14 | 14 | 14 |
| Temperature Range | -40.0°C ~ 85.0°C | -40.0°C ~ 85.0°C | -40.0°C ~ 85.0°C |
| Price | $1.5554 | — | $1.5554 |
| Electrical Parameters | |||
| Pbfree Code | Yes | Yes | No |
| YTEOL | 3.9 | 3.9 | 0 |
| Amplifier Type | OPERATIONAL AMPLIFIER | OPERATIONAL AMPLIFIER | OPERATIONAL AMPLIFIER |
| Architecture | VOLTAGE-FEEDBACK | VOLTAGE-FEEDBACK | VOLTAGE-FEEDBACK |
| Average Bias Current-Max (IIB) | 1 µA | 1 µA | 7 µA |
| Bandwidth (3dB)-Nom | 24 MHz | 24 MHz | — |
| Bias Current-Max (IIB) @25C | 1 µA | 1 µA | 1 µA |
| Common-mode Reject Ratio-Min | 75 dB | 75 dB | 70 dB |
| Common-mode Reject Ratio-Nom | 105 dB | 105 dB | 105 dB |
| Frequency Compensation | YES | YES | YES |
| Input Offset Current-Max (IIO) | 0.15 µA | 0.15 µA | — |
| Input Offset Voltage-Max | 4000 µV | 4000 µV | 6000 µV |
| JESD-30 Code | R-PDSO-G14 | R-PDSO-G14 | R-PDSO-G14 |
| JESD-609 Code | e3 | e3 | e0 |
| Low-Bias | NO | NO | NO |
| Low-Offset | NO | NO | NO |
| Micropower | NO | NO | NO |
| Number of Functions | 4 | 4 | 4 |
| Package Body Material | PLASTIC/EPOXY | PLASTIC/EPOXY | PLASTIC/EPOXY |
| Package Equivalence Code | SOP14,.25 | SOP14,.25 | SOP14,.25 |
| Package Shape | RECTANGULAR | RECTANGULAR | RECTANGULAR |
| Package Style | SMALL OUTLINE | SMALL OUTLINE | SMALL OUTLINE |
| Packing Method | TUBE | TR | RAIL |
| Peak Reflow Temperature (Cel) | 260 | 260 | 235 |
| Power | NO | NO | NO |
| Programmable Power | NO | NO | NO |
| Qualification Status | Not Qualified | Not Qualified | Not Qualified |
| Slew Rate-Min | 8 V/us | 8 V/us | — |
| Slew Rate-Nom | 11 V/us | 11 V/us | 11 V/us |
| Subcategory | Operational Amplifier | Operational Amplifier | — |
| Supply Current-Max | 6 mA | 6 mA | 6 mA |
| Supply Voltage Limit-Max | 18 V | 18 V | 18 V |
| Supply Voltage-Nom (Vsup) | 5 V | 5 V | 5 V |
| Surface Mount | YES | YES | YES |
| Technology | BIPOLAR | BIPOLAR | BIPOLAR |
| Temperature Grade | INDUSTRIAL | INDUSTRIAL | INDUSTRIAL |
| Terminal Finish | Tin (Sn) | Matte Tin (Sn) | TIN LEAD |
| Terminal Form | GULL WING | GULL WING | GULL WING |
| Terminal Pitch | 1.27 mm | 1.27 mm | 1.27 mm |
| Terminal Position | DUAL | DUAL | DUAL |
| Time@Peak Reflow Temperature-Max (s) | 30 | 30 | 20 |
| Unity Gain BW-Nom | 15300 | 15300 | 15300 |
| Voltage Gain-Min | 5600 | 5600 | 5600 |
| Wideband | NO | NO | NO |
Cells highlighted in yellow indicate differing values across parts. Always verify with official datasheets before substitution.
